With the growth in the business, Burlington Stone is investing in the expansion of its U.S. market by employing a new sales manager specifically to work the eastern seaboard. Tony Gear, recently recruited to Burlington, will join Phil Harding and Fiona Cameron. 

With an aim to work more directly with specifiers and clients, Gear will endeavor to balance direct specified products while maintaining longstanding relationships with distributors.

Gear has joined Burlington Stone after gaining over 25 years experience in the resin flooring industry.  “ I am looking forward to this new challenge and the exciting opportunity to play a part in continuing to grow the business for Burlington Stone in the U.S.,” he said.
